Job Summary

The Manufacturing Operator reports to the Shift Supervisor and is responsible for learning and performing various pharmaceutical manufacturing techniques including dispensing, blending and granulation, compression, encapsulation, and coating.

Cross-training is provided, as needed, upon the mastering of each technique. The Operator is expected to complete all tasks by adhering to GMP and Safety guidelines at all times, including following proper documentation and gowning procedures.

Responsibilities and Learning Opportunities

Duties listed below may include one or several of the manufacturing techniques (i.e. granulation, blending, compression, encapsulation, coating etc.

depending on knowledge and experience level

  • Cleaning of product rooms and equipment such as mills, mixers, ovens, granulators etc.
  • Operation of granulation equipment
  • Operate all Coating equipment i.e., Coating Pans (Accela Cota, Compulab) dust collector, air handling unit and delivery apparatus.
  • Check and document weight of all powder blends when received from Blending Department
  • Copress / Encapsulate product as specified in the batch Manufacturing Records.
  • Document process as specified in BMR
  • Operate all Encapsulation equipment i.e., IMA Matic 90, IMatic 150, Adapta encapsulators, Precisa 12, 120 weight sorters, scales and metals detectors.
  • Clean all equipment in the Encapsulation and Tablet Compression department
  • Operate all tablet compression equipment i.e. Kilian S520, Syntheses 500, tablet presses, drum lifters, deduster, metal detectors, scales, micrometers, hardness testers, printers, and inspection machines
  • Will assure the Department and work areas are kept clean and orderly. Clean equipment as specified by SOPs and Department Supervisor.
  • Will constantly observe and practice all cGMP policies and procedures in all work performed.
  • Observe and adhere to Department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and Safety Polices in all work performed. Adhere to work schedule, and perform other duties as assigned.
  • Must participate and successfully complete all training as required by the company.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Physical Demands

The physical demands here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job.

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

While performing the duties of this job, the employee is frequently required to sit, use hand and fingers, to manipulate objects, tools, or controls;

and reach with hands and arms. The employee is occasionally required to stand, walk, st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l, and talk or hear.

The employee must regularly lift and / or move up to 30 pounds, frequently lift and / or move up to 25 / 65 p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, color, peripheral, depth perception and the ability to adjust focus.
